Overview
- Organisers report 1,026 new releases this year—694 books, 163 music productions, 30 magazines and 139 other works—across 285 stands with 273 scheduled events.
- Ahotsenea is running 8–10 daytime concerts daily from December 5–8 (11:00–22:00), featuring 38 artists, including 12 presenting debut albums.
- For the first time, ticketed late-night shows at Plateruena extend the program after hours: Lukiek and Ezezez performed on December 5, with Mirua and Naxker slated for December 6; tickets cost 5 or 10 euros.
- Illustrators have a new, dedicated presence through Atartea and a Landako stand, which participants say boosts much-needed visibility and highlights professional concerns such as precarity and AI use.
- Beyond books and music, the fair’s cross-disciplinary slate includes theatre and dance at Szenatokia, while EHU is presenting 40 new works linked to Basque language and culture, 30 of them in Basque.
